If your pipes freeze, turn on the water from the faucet nearest them to let water out when they start to thaw. This gives the pressure somewhere to go, and can keep them from bursting.
Obnoxiously loud pipes that like to squeal and hammer are easy situations to correct. Exposed pipes will have to be anchored. If pipes are located in the floor, ceiling or walls, you might want to have a professional help you complete the project.

If your garbage disposal is not working correctly, you should not try to fix it by putting your hand in through the drain. A garbage disposal can be dangerous, even when it is not on. Look for a diagram of the garbage disposal you have on the Internet.
If your house uses well water and you start to see orange or pink stains in your tub and other water fixtures, you have too much iron in your water. This can be remedied by using a water softener which can be purchased at a shop, or a company can pay a visit to your home and handle the situation for you.
You can keep your bathtub pipes clear by pouring baking soda and vinegar down your drain once a month. Use one cup of each. Afterward, place a washcloth or towel over the top of the drain, to keep the chemical reactions contained. After waiting a few minutes, flush the drain with boiling water. Your pipes will soon be clear of accumulated hair and soap scum.

Overflow Holes
You should make sure that the holes are not stopped up on the overflow. The overflow holes are there to make sure the sink doesn’t overfill, which can become a problem if they are blocked. Make sure to clean out the overflow holes each time you do maintenance checks on your sinks.
If you operate the disposal on your sink, run plenty of cool water. Cold water helps to maintain the sharpness of the blades and makes the disposal run more smoothly. Hot water will liquefy grease and build up inside the drain, eventually causing clogs.

Avoid using drain cleaners as much as possible. Drain cleaners are composed of extremely corrosive chemicals and can actually damage pipes with frequent use. Call a professional if you notice your drain is still clogged up.
If valves are seldom used they may become fused. Keep them maintained and functioning properly by applying penetrating oil. It’s also a good idea to occasionally turn the valves. This will prevent them from getting stuck together.

When you replace a water heater, be sure to reconnect the secondary pipe that sticks out from the drain pipe, if one is there. This could be one of the recirculation pipes, which helps your water stay warm without wasting it.
Do this little test to investigate whether your toilet leaks. You can do this by coloring the water in your tank. If you see the coloring after a few seconds, you will know that there is a problem with your toilet that needs immediate attention.

Certain things, like chicken skin, carrots and bananas, can actually get caught in the blades and result in a clogged garbage disposal. Be sure to dispose of these hard-to-grind materials first, throwing them in the garbage can, before placing other food in the garbage disposal.
If your pipes are copper, they may slightly expand when hot water flows through them. This expansion causes the pipes to become misaligned with the pipe hanger. This can damage the pipes over time. To avoid damaging your pipes, layer the ends of the pipe with tape to ensure that they will stay securely connected to the hanger.
If your washing machine drain overflows, try using a run of the mill pipe snake in it. Sometimes, lint or small thing from the machine get caught in the pipe and clog it.
